npx shadcn@latest add "https://webberui.com/r/real-estate-agency.json?t=<install token>"The whole page lands in app/templates/real-estate-agency/. You can also use a long-lived licence key instead: set the Authorization: Bearer <key> header in the registries block of components.json — better for CI or a project several people share. What you get is source code
Not an npm package, not a zip file. Once installed, the page's TypeScript source sits in your repo: edit it however you like, no runtime dependency, no expiry mechanism. Your site keeps running even if ours goes down.
